287 Matches for Neil Hagge

Neil Hagge

Florissant, MO

Neil Hagge lives in Florissant, Missouri.


Neil Hagge

Walker, LA

Neil Hagge lives in Walker, LA.


Neil Hagge

Pine Ridge, SD

Neil Hagge lives in Pine Ridge, SD.


Neil Hagge

Des Plaines, IL

Neil Hagge lives in Des Plaines, IL.


Public Records & Background Search

Arrest Records & Driving Infractions

Phonebook

Email Addresses

Contact Information & Address History

Wikipedia

Web Search

People also ask

Scroll